feat(BridgeChannel): Signal a new videoType for high fps screenshare.
This lets the bridge adjust the bitrate allocation for this source so that layers with higher fps are prioritized over layers with higher resolution.
As a result, endpoints with restricted downlink will receive a high fps low resolution share as opposed to a high resolution low fps screenshare.

feat(stats): Add a new bridge message "EndpointStats" for stats.
Use the new Colibri message "EndpointStats" for broadcasting the local stats. The bridge then will be able to filter the endpoint stats and send them only to the interested parties instead of broadcasting it to all the endpoints in the call.

* feat(JingleSessionPC): Remove ssrcs from remote desc when a user leaves.
Remove the ssrcs (associated with remote sources) from the remote desc along with the removal of the remote tracks when an endpoint leaves the call. The source-remove signaling message from Jicofo will no longer be needed in this case and can be dropped.

ref(QualityController): Split send and receive video constraints handling.
All the send video constraints for the client, i.e., what simulcast streams will be enabled based on constraints received on the bridge channel, will be handled by the SendVideoController class.
The receive video constraints like lastN, selectEndpoints and receive video resolution will be handled by the ReceiveVideoController class.

Delays e2e encryption initialization until any encryption key is set.
Recreates peerconnections in order to enable insertable streams
only if the e2ee is used. This is to avoid bug around insertable streams
which may cause audio issue when the main JavaScript thread is loaded:
https://bugs.chromium.org/p/chromium/issues/detail?id=1103280
